Handover for the returning leased laptops from the Brellick contract. Fourteen units, wiped and asset-tagged, packed in two crates with foam dividers. Chargers are bagged separately inside crate two. Lanner Courier Services collects Thursday morning and delivers to your intake desk at the Ostvale depot. Confirm crate count on arrival and sign the manifest. The courier must present this release code:

courier memo of yawep-yafog: the pramir ulaix courier leaves the ulavan aldix frair zorok oliiel joreth rusdor fenvan ledger at gate 1305 under passcode 514738

Subject: Dispatcher heuristic update shipping Thursday

Team — the Routewell driver-assignment heuristic now weights shift-end proximity ahead of raw distance, which in staging reduced late handoffs by 12% without increasing idle time. Marit verified the scoring change against three weeks of replayed dispatch logs from the Ellsmere region. Rollout is gated at 10% of zones for 48 hours, with automatic revert if reassignment latency exceeds the p95 budget. For auditing, please record the release against the build token below.

pipeline stamp: htk31_f769b577b3028a4e9958e5bb8d1259a

Subject: Handover — Corvid hermetic build migration

Deepa,

Status for the eng sync: Corvid's build is 70% migrated to the Stonemill hermetic system. Remaining blockers: the codegen step still shells out to a system compiler, and two vendored libs fetch at build time. Fixes in review. CI runs both builds in parallel; hermetic is green except the flaky proto check. Don't cut a release from Stonemill output yet.

If anyone at the sync needs details before Thursday, they can reach me here.

escalation mailbox, bafog-fafog: ulador@paliqlabs.internal

## Receipt Mailer API — Givewell Grove

The mailer sends donation receipts within five minutes of a confirmed payment. Support can resend via `POST /receipts/resend` with the donation reference; duplicates are suppressed for 24 hours. Failed sends appear in the bounce queue and retry three times. All requests require the internal support key in the `X-Grove-Key` header, shown below.

API key for yahig-tadup: kto7_ubizbYm